Regaine for Men: An Effective Solution for Hair Loss

Male pattern baldness affects males of all ages and ethnicities.In fact, according to the American Hair Loss Association, two-thirds of American men experience some degree of hair loss by the age of 35. Factors such as heredity, age, hormonal shifts, and medical disorders all play a role in hair thinning or loss. While hair loss is a natural part of the aging process for many men, it can also be a source of stress and self-consciousness. Fortunately, there are a variety of treatments available that can help prevent and even reverse hair loss, including Regaine for Men.

What is Regaine for Men?

Regaine for Men is a topical solution that contains the active ingredient minoxidil. As a vasodilator, minoxidil expands blood arteries to boost circulation. In the case of hair loss, minoxidil works by increasing blood flow to the hair follicles, which can stimulate hair growth.

Regaine for Men is available in two strengths: 2% and 5% minoxidil. The 2% solution is recommended for men who are just starting to experience hair loss, while the 5% solution is recommended for men with more advanced hair loss. Both strengths are applied topically to the scalp twice a day, and results can be seen within two to four months.

How Does Regaine for Men Work?

Regaine for Men works by increasing blood flow to the hair follicles, which can stimulate hair growth. The exact mechanism of action is not fully understood, but it is believed that minoxidil widens blood vessels in the scalp, allowing more oxygen and nutrients to reach the hair follicles. This increased blood flow can stimulate the hair follicles to enter the anagen (growth) phase of the hair cycle, which can lead to thicker, fuller hair.

Regaine for Men is most effective when used in the early stages of hair loss. If hair loss has progressed to the point where there is significant baldness or thinning, Regaine for Men may not be as effective. Additionally, it is important to note that while Regaine for Men can stimulate hair growth, it cannot reverse the underlying causes of hair loss. Therefore, it is important to continue using Regaine for Men as directed to maintain the results.

Are There Any Side Effects of Using Regaine for Men?

Like all medications, Regaine for Men can cause side effects. The most common side effect is irritation or itching of the scalp. This is usually mild and temporary, but in some cases, it can be more severe. Other possible side effects include:

  • Dryness or flaking of the scalp
  • Redness or rash on the scalp
  • Increased hair loss in the first few weeks of treatment (this is a temporary side effect and is actually a sign that the treatment is working)
  • Dizziness or lightheadedness (this is rare and usually occurs when too much of the medication is absorbed into the bloodstream)

It is important to follow the instructions on the packaging carefully and to speak with a healthcare provider if you experience any severe side effects.

Who Should Not Use Regaine for Men?

Regaine for Men is not suitable for everyone. It should not be used by:

  • Women (there is a separate product, Regaine for Women, which is designed for women)
  • Children under 18 years old
  • Men with a history of hypersensitivity to minoxidil or any of the other ingredients in the product
  • Men with scalp conditions such as psoriasis or eczema

It is important to speak with a healthcare provider before starting treatment with Regaine for Men to ensure that it is safe for you to use.

Are There Any Alternatives to Regaine for Men?

While Regaine for Men is a popular and effective treatment for hair loss, there are other options available. Some other treatments for hair loss include:

Finasteride:

Oral finasteride is a prescribed drug for hair loss. It works by blocking the production of dihydrotestosterone (DHT), a hormone that is responsible for hair loss in men. Finasteride is most effective for men with mild to moderate hair loss and should be taken daily for at least three months to see results.

Hair transplant surgery:

Hair transplant surgery involves taking hair follicles from a donor area of the scalp (usually the back or sides of the head) and transplanting them to the bald or thinning areas. This is a surgical treatment that is usually done with only a little bit of numbing. Hair transplant surgery can be expensive and requires a recovery period, but it is a permanent solution to hair loss.

Low-level laser therapy:

Low-level laser therapy involves using a special device that emits low-level lasers to stimulate hair growth. This treatment can be done at home or in a clinic and is typically used in combination with other treatments.

Topical corticosteroids:

 Topical corticosteroids are anti-inflammatory medications that can help reduce inflammation in the scalp and promote hair growth. They are often use in tandem with other methods of care.

It is important to speak with a healthcare provider before starting any treatment for hair loss to ensure that it is safe and effective for you.
